How To Use Airplane Mode To Appear Switched Off

One way to make your mobile number appear switched off to a specific contact is by using the Airplane Mode feature on your smartphone. When you activate Airplane Mode, your device will disconnect from all wireless networks, including cellular and Wi-Fi connections. As a result, incoming calls, messages, and notifications from the specific contact will not be delivered to your phone, making it appear as if your number is switched off.

To use Airplane Mode, simply swipe down from the top of your screen or go to the settings menu on your smartphone, and then select the Airplane Mode option. Once activated, your phone will display an airplane icon in the status bar, indicating that it is in airplane mode. It’s important to note that while in Airplane Mode, you won’t be able to make or receive calls, send or receive messages, or access the internet unless you disable Airplane Mode. Third-Party Apps For Call Blocking

There are several third-party apps available that can help you effectively block calls from specific contacts. These apps offer advanced call-blocking features that allow you to customize call filtering based on specific phone numbers. Some of these apps also provide the option to send callers directly to voicemail or simply block the call altogether, making it appear as if your mobile number is switched off to the specific contact.

Popular third-party call-blocking apps often come with additional features such as SMS blocking, schedule-based call blocking, and even the ability to create whitelists and blacklists for your contacts. These apps can be easily downloaded and installed from the Google Play Store or Apple App Store, providing an easy and convenient solution for managing unwanted calls from specific contacts.

Using Mobile Network Settings To Block Contacts

Using Mobile Network Settings to Block Contacts

Most mobile phones have the option to block specific contacts through the mobile network settings. This feature allows you to selectively prevent certain contacts from reaching you while still remaining accessible to others. By accessing the settings menu and navigating to the “Call” or “SMS” settings, you can find the option to block specific numbers. Once in the settings, you can add the contact you wish to block to a blacklist, thus preventing their calls and messages from reaching your device.

In addition, some mobile network providers offer the option to block calls and messages from specific contacts directly through their services. This feature can usually be accessed by logging into your account on the provider’s website or app and navigating to the “Manage Settings” or “Privacy Settings” section. From there, you can add the contact you want to block to your blacklist, ensuring that their attempts to contact you are unsuccessful.
